Employment Law Legends, Episode 3 – Testing Title VII: Griggs v. Duke Power Company

In the third episode of Employment Law Legends, Paul Rinnan discusses Griggs v. Duke Power Company, the origins of the disparate impact theory, and the legal battle to define discrimination in the civil rights era.
